Paid Online Surveys, Get-Paid-To-Click And Other Scams
If you've ever googled for internet business, make money online or related search termes on a search engine, then you've probably come across some dodgy websites that promised you could make easy money by taking online surveys or to pay you big cash just for clicking a few websites per day (Get-
Paid-Per-Click). Some might even masquerade as "review sites" that "warn" of you of frequent online scams - just to make you click yet another link to the "ultimate make-easy-money-online" website, 100% no scam, of course. You might even have to pay a "registration fee" to get access to a database of online survey providers, and they will all give you the most logical reasons why companies should pay you to get your opinion! Market research (online surveys) saves companies from billion $ losses they might otherwise have to invest into developing new products which no-one would ever buy - so they would rather give you a piece of the cake!? The truth, unfortunately, is that companies will still not share their profits with you for giving them your valuable opinion :(
As far as online surveys are concerned (I won't waste my time with Paid-Per-
Click sites), I have personally tested a few online survey sites, initially hoping for easy cash. To be fair, I haven't made only negative experiences but I have definitely made no money. To cut a long story short: serious market research companies will most probably not pay you big cash for taking surveys online, even if so, payments are extremely low in comparison to the time it takes to take a professional survey. And you should not expect a dozen or so surveys every day either; most likely (depending on your profile) you would receive an invitation by email to participate in a new survey not more than a few times per month.
Less serious survey websites might, at least in the beginning, virtually spam you with email invitations to take super-easy online surveys which insist of nothing else than clicking a fancy website banner, staying on that site for 30 or so seconds and writing a one-sentence review about it. I have managed to accumulate a few dollars within minutes on one these sites - then less and less "surveys" were available, and I finally have up without ever reaching the "payout minimum". In other words, just a waste of time.
More dangerous websites might promise on their homepage to reveal the ten magic secrets of "how to make easy money online" and then require you to purchase a useless e-book - with which purchase they might pass on the right to you to resell this e-book to others. Such dodgy websites, run by "online marketing gurus", are 99.9% not just a waste of time but also a
waste of money. Caution!
Ebay Auctions - PayPal
Selling products on Ebay or similar auction sites, on the other hand, might seriously provide you with a lucrative second income, provided you've done some "market research" and offer the right product at the right price. There are probably dozens of products which are cheaper in Thailand than in your home country, and if you're short of ideas what might be worth selling, just search for Thailand-related articles on Ebay and see what your competitors offer at what prices - then simply copy their business ideas until you have found a "niche" that suits your personal interest? To start with, how about Thai handicrafts, Muay Thai boxer shorts, T-shirts, leather belts or health products? Just go on a shopping tour to a local market and keep in mind what people from your home country would buy if they were in Thailand themselves?
Payment is generally easy via PayPal. However, if you have a Thai-registered Ebay account and want to receive payments in Thailand or pay for your Ebay fees via PayPal (in which case you have to upload funds from your Thai bank account to your PayPal account), you might face stiff difficulties when trying to couple your Thai bank account with your PayPal account. In order to verify a PayPal account, usually credit card information is required, and chances to have a credit card issued as a foreigner in Thailand are very, very low. Some have reported they successfully coupled Bangkok Bank or K-Bank accounts with their Thai-registered PayPal accounts by using ordinary Visa Electron debit cards (ATM cards); other Thai debit cards (e.g. TMB Visa debit card) will simply not be accepted by PayPal's strict verification system.
Warning: Be careful when selling products on Ebay (or similar websites) that
violate international copyright laws (fake designer clothing, football shirts or "Rolex" watches). First, your articles might simply get lost at the customs in their destination country, secondly, Ebay would at least ban you if a client filed an official complaint with them or Ebay otherwise found out you were selling fake products (not to mention, legal consequences).

So what do you need to get your own website online?
Domain name
In order to publish a website on the web you will need to purchase a domain name. A domain is so-to-say the "name" of a website or "web address", e.g. www.mywebsite.com. Depending on the kind or geographical target of your website business, different extensions are available, e.g. .com, .org, .biz, .info, .us, .co.uk and many more. Domain names can be purchased directly from a domain name registrar or, indirectly, through one or more layers of resellers, e.g. a web host. Prices vary roughly between $ 8-30 per year.
Web Hosting Service
Once you have purchased a domain name, you'll need a web host in order to publish your site on the internet. Web hosting service "allows individuals and organizations or companies to provide their own website accessible via the World Wide Web. Web hosts are companies that provide space on a server they own for use by their clients as well as providing Internet connectivity".
When publishing your website it will be uploaded to the IP address of "your" server. Most commonly your web site will be placed on the same server as many other sites, ranging from a few to hundreds or thousands (Shared Web Hosting). Advertisement-supported free web hosting services are available as well and might be fully sufficient for single-page personal websites but cannot be recommended for commercial use.

How To Create A Website Without HTML Knowledge?
No or, depending on which program you choose to use, only verly little HTML or coding knowledge is required to create your own website when using a so-
called WYSIWYG editor or website builder. WYSIWYG stands for What you see is what you get. WYSIWYG editors are code generators - their software automatically generates the code (HTML or whatsoever) which is the base of every web page. The interface you see of offline on your monitor screen when creating a page (before publishing it to the web) resembles pretty much what this page will actually look like when vistors view it online in a web browser. The difference is that you can edit it - commonly by using a simple "drag & drop" sitebuilder system.
"Drag & drop" means that - instead of writing the website code itself - all you have to do is click symbols in toolbars to insert text boxes, image boxes or whatever features are abailable, and simply fill this box with your text. The sitebuilder software will then automatically convert your pages to e.g. HTML and make them readable for search engines.
Of course, not all WYSIWYG website builders provide users with the same functionality and value for money. Some website builders are easier to use than others, some offer less, others more advanced features; some might have the drawback that they tie you to expensive web hosting contracts; some might be cheaper than competitors, others are totally free.

Affiliate Marketing: How To Make Money With Your Website?
The truth is: If your website provides only information and you don't sell any original products to your visitors directly, you will probably find it hard to turn your website into a lucrative business. Most likely you will not even half-way make a living - unless you've managed to build up mutual trust between you and your visitors and you get a few hundreds of them (at least) on your site every day. In the latter case so-called "Affiliate Marketing" might well provide you with an additional income. Most probably this might be pocket money only, and you will definitely not become a millionaire or "rich jerk" by simply promoting affiliate programs. However, depending the subject and quality of your site, the number of visitors you get per day and their readiness to click your affiliate ads and get engaged in business activities (purchase a product, sign up for a service or similar), you might be lucky and earn a decent extra income?
So what is "affiliate marketing"?
Affiliate marketing - using one website to drive traffic to another - is an online advertising channel in which advertisers (online merchants that sell products or services) pay web publishers (that promote the products or services of an advertiser on their website) only when the new client introduction results in a business engagement ("pay-for-performance" model). In practice this means, your affiliate website promotes products or services provided by your affiliate partners by displaying their ads and placing links (banner links, text links or similar) to their websites on your pages. In case a visitor on your site clicks a qualified link or, more typically, in case of a visitor's business engagement (sale or lead) via a link from your site, you earn a commision.
There are thousands of affiliate programs to choose from that are willing to partner up with you; however, you have to make the right choice and make sure the products or services you promote somehow match the subject of your own site. Affiliate ads placed on your site should appear as a useful addition to the contents of your pages and match your visitor's interests as otherwise they simply won't click them. In other words - if your website is about cats, don't advertise for dog training schools.
Tip: If you cannot think of suitable affiliate programs that match your site's contents and visitor's interests, just google one of your main keywords (e.g. "cat food") in combination with the search term "affiliate program" = "cat food affiliate program". Google AdSense is a Google-run ad serving program that allows webmasters
(= publishers) to display Google advertisements on their pages and get "paid per click". This means, every time a visitor clicks a Google ad, Google pays you money. This money comes from Google AdWords advertisers who pay Google to promote their websites via Google AdSense. So indirectly those websites whose ads are displayed in Google AdSense boxes on your site pay you per click (visitors generated by a link from your site).
Webmasters can easily enroll in this program to enable text, image and, more recently, video ads on their sites. These ads generate revenue on either a paid-per-click or per-thousand-impressions basis. The AdWords advertiser chooses the page(s) to display ads on and pays based on CPM (cost-per-
thousand-impressions, or the price advertisers choose to pay for every thousand ads displayed).
